Description

Are you looking for fun and engaging Multiplication Facts Practice during the December Holidays? These Holidays Around the World Math Fact Activities are perfect for Multiplication and Division Fact Fluency Practice Fun.

Your kiddos will gain multiplication and division fact power with this packet of

true or false fun - the December Holidays version.

Use these multiplication and division practice pages for math centers, buddy activities, peer tutoring, small group activities, homework independent review or enrichment.

What's Included on this Christmas Holidays Math Resource

a total of 22 Practice Pages.

11 True or False Multiplication practice pages.

Each page focuses on multiplying by one factor.

There is one page for the following numbers factors - 2 through 12

11 True or False Division practice pages.

Each page focuses on dividing by one number.

There is one page for the following numbers 2-12

December Holiday Clipart includes

★Christmas

★Gingerbread Man

★Hanukkah

★Diwali

★Kwanzaa

Directions

★Cut out the number sentences.

★Sort in the true or false category.

★Glue

★Color the holiday fun picture.

These multiplication and division activities are great for fast finishers and can be done in a small group or independently.

Standards

to see state-specific standards (only available in the US).
Fluently multiply and divide within 100, using strategies such as the relationship between multiplication and division (e.g., knowing that 8 × 5 = 40, one knows 40 ÷ 5 = 8) or properties of operations. By the end of Grade 3, know from memory all products of two one-digit numbers.
